Isabel has a new wubby, which she sleeps with every night, without fail. It is an off-white cable knit cashmere sweater, that was a favorite of mine until i spilled something down the front of it, and failed miserably in my attempt at removing the stain.  I learned a valuable lesson that i will not repeat - that bleach and white wool do not get along.  My attempt at spot treating the stain with a small amount of bleach only made the situation worse, as I later found out that white wool effectively burns and turns ORANGE when bleached.  Not quite ready to toss out an expensive and otherwise loved cashmere sweater, I left it lying around, contemplating whether it could be reborn as a throw pillow or something else. But Isabel soon claimed it as her own.

Isabel's Wubby

The old cashmere sweater is now a permanent fixture at the foot of our bed, and every night you can watch the same ritual being perfomed - Kneading the sweater, with eyes closed or sometime partially opened, her eyeballs rolling back in her head, and purring at full volume.  Sometimes she stretches herself out along a single arm of the sweater.  Sometimes she circles a few times and plants herself in the center, with the arms encircling. A few times we’ve offered to open the body of the sweater, and she climbs inside, and sticks her head outside the neck hole, as if she were wearing it.  All in all, its pretty cute. There will be no getting rid of this sweater anytime soon.
